BioAgilytix has built its reputation on meeting exactly this need. As a global contract research organization (CRO), the company supports drug development programs from early discovery through clinical trials and commercialization, providing the bioanalytical insights that underpin critical decisions. Founded in 2008 and headquartered in Durham, North Carolina, BioAgilytix has evolved into a trusted partner for both emerging biotech innovators and established pharmaceutical leaders.
What distinguishes BioAgilytix is not just the breadth of its services, but the scientific depth behind them. The company specializes in large-molecule bioanalysis, a field that has become increasingly central as biologic therapies dominate new drug pipelines. Its expertise spans pharmacokinetics (PK), immunogenicity, biomarkers, and cell-based assays—critical components in understanding how therapies behave in the body and how patients respond to them. This capability is delivered through a comprehensive suite of services that includes assay development, validation, and sample analysis across multiple regulatory frameworks, including GLP, GCP, and GMP environments. These services ensure that data generated throughout the development process meets the stringent requirements of global regulatory agencies, enabling clients to move forward with confidence.
BioAgilytix’s role extends across the full drug development lifecycle. In early stages, the company helps design and validate assays that can accurately measure therapeutic activity. As programs progress into clinical trials, its laboratories provide high-quality sample analysis and biomarker insights that guide dosing strategies, safety assessments, and efficacy evaluations. At later stages, its capabilities support product release testing and stability analysis, ensuring that therapies meet regulatory and quality standards before reaching patients. This end-to-end support is made possible by a global laboratory network strategically located across North America, Europe, and Australia. Facilities in key biopharma hubs such as Boston, San Diego, and Hamburg enable BioAgilytix to support multinational clinical trials while maintaining consistent quality and regulatory compliance across regions.
